dirname(1) - Linux man page
Name
dirname - strip non-directory suffix from file nameSynopsis
dirname NAMEdirname OPTION
Description
Print NAME with its trailing /component removed; if NAME contains no /'s, output '.' (meaning the current directory).
- --help
- display this help and exit
- --version
- output version information and exit
Examples
- dirname /usr/bin/sort
- Output "/usr/bin".
- dirname stdio.h
- Output ".".
